Natural course of migraine attacks described

Published in Medical Letter on the CDC and FDA, July 9th, 2006

Researchers describe the natural course of migraine attacks in a recent issue of Cephalalgia.

"This study was designed to document prospectively and explore scientifically the natural course of untreated migraine attacks in detail. A new, integrated, time-intensity method for self-assessment of the intensity of symptoms was tested on 18 adult International Headache Society migraineurs who volunteered to refrain from treatment during one attack. The area under the curves (AUC) during 72 hours of untreated attacks was compared with attacks treated with a triptan," scientists in Sweden report.
